Summary of the Alabama Secretary of State Offerings

The Alabama Secretary of State offers a selection of solutions that serve a crucial role in supporting businesses operating in the state. One of the key services is the Alabama Secretary of State entity search. This tool allows users and companies to access essential information about licensed businesses, including their standing, ownership, and registration details. By using the Alabama SOS entity search, company leaders can confirm the validity of their competitors or partners, ensuring they are making informed decisions in their career engagements.

Another important service is the the Alabama Secretary of State company search. This enables clients to search particularly for corporations registered in Alabama, delivering detailed records that can help clarify the organization and functions of these entities. The details retrieved can cover corporate filings, changes in leadership, and additional vital details that contribute to clear business practices. Additionally, the Alabama Secretary of State LLC search delivers specific results for LLCs, which are an ever more popular choice for commercial structures.

For individuals looking to reserve their company name, the Alabama Secretary of State business name search is an invaluable tool. This resource helps entrepreneurs confirm whether their desired company name is available, reducing the risk of naming conflicts. Furthermore, the the Alabama Secretary of State Uniform Commercial Code search provides businesses with the ability to search for any liens or security interests in the name they wish to register, guaranteeing they safeguard their company’s future. Together, these services foster a supportive environment for business growth and connection inside Alabama.

Ways to Conduct a Corporate Search in Alabama

Performing a business search in Alabama is a simple procedure. Begin by visiting the Secretary of State of Alabama's website, where you will find a focused area for business entity searches. This resource allows you to access multiple categories of data, including information on businesses, LLCs, and other business entities filed in the state. To start your inquiry, you can type the business name, the owner's name, or even the company's registration number, if present.

For those wanting additional information, employ the Alabama Secretary of State business entity search options such as the Alabama SOS entity search or the Alabama corporation search by the Secretary of State. These tools provide information into the standing of the company, including its formation date, registered agents, and any logged records. Making use of these resources can help confirm that you are working with a genuine business or assist in the formation of your own company.

Finally, if you seek additional assistance, the website offers guides and ways to contact for the Alabama Secretary of State's department. Whether you are an startup founder looking to establish a new LLC or a client verifying a entity's legitimacy, performing a comprehensive lookup can provide you with the necessary information to make informed decisions. Ensure that you effectively use these tools efficiently to comprehend the business landscape in the state of Alabama.

Suggestions for Effective Directory Listings

To enhance your directory listing, ensure that your business information is accurate and current. This includes your business name, address, phone number, and website link. Coherence is key across all platforms, as variations can confuse potential customers and hurt your search engine rankings. A well-defined description of your services or products can also help attract the right audience.

High-quality images can enhance your directory listing greatly. Visual appeal is important for drawing attention and encouraging clicks. Invest in expertly taken pictures that represent your business well, whether they are images of your products, your storefront, or your team.
